4,500+ servers built on MCP Fusion
Vinkius
MoeGo logo
Vinkius
OpenAI Agents SDK logo

How to Use the MoeGo MCP in OpenAI Agents SDK

Run your pet grooming business on autopilot using the OpenAI Agents SDK to manage appointments, staff, and customer records.

See Vinkius in Action

Works with every AI agent you already use

…and any MCP-compatible client

MoeGo MCP on Cursor AI Code Editor MCP Client MoeGo MCP on Claude Desktop App MCP Integration MoeGo MCP on OpenAI Agents SDK MCP Compatible MoeGo MCP on Visual Studio Code MCP Extension Client MoeGo MCP on GitHub Copilot AI Agent MCP Integration MoeGo MCP on Google Gemini AI MCP Integration MoeGo MCP on Lovable AI Development MCP Client MoeGo MCP on Mistral AI Agents MCP Compatible MoeGo MCP on Amazon AWS Bedrock MCP Support
MCP Servers - Free for Subscribers
OpenAI Agents SDK

Connect MoeGo MCP to OpenAI Agents SDK

Create your Vinkius account to connect MoeGo to OpenAI Agents SDK and route execution through our secure gateway. The platform manages server hosting, runtime updates, and security layers. Configuration requires no manual server provisioning.

GDPR Free for Subscribers

Auto-discover grooming tools with OpenAI Agents SDK

The `list_appointments` tool exposes your entire grooming schedule directly to your OpenAI agents using this MCP Server. Passing the server configuration block to the agent constructor maps out every route needed to check bookings or fetch pet profiles without manual route definition. Setting `cacheToolsList=True` ensures your agent does not waste latency querying the server schema on every message. Your scheduling stays fast when clients call to confirm times or when the agent needs to check `get_business_settings` to verify opening hours.

Secure booking workflows with built-in guardrails

The `create_appointment` tool lets your agent write new bookings directly into your database after verifying slot availability. Because the OpenAI Agents SDK forces strict schema validation before running tools, you do not have to worry about the agent sending malformed dates or invalid staff IDs to the MoeGo API. If a customer requests a specific groomer, the agent uses `list_staff` to find active employees and matches them against the selected service from `list_services`. The SDK guardrail blocks the API call immediately if the agent tries to book a service that does not exist.

Multi-agent handoffs for custom pet care pipelines

The `list_reviews` tool monitors customer satisfaction across all pet care visits. This MoeGo MCP Server allows you to split operations between specialized agents, like a booking agent and a customer feedback agent. When a bad review comes in, the feedback agent can automatically hand off the conversation to the scheduling agent. That agent then uses `get_appointment` to look up the exact visit details and offers a resolution, keeping your operations organized without a single monolithic prompt.

Setup guide

Set up MoeGo MCP in OpenAI Agents SDK

Prerequisites

  • Python 3.10+ installed
  • openai-agents package (pip install openai-agents)
  • Active Vinkius subscription with a valid endpoint token
  1. 1

    Install the SDK

    Run pip install openai-agents to install the OpenAI Agents SDK. The MCP integration is built-in — no extra dependencies needed.

  2. 2

    Connect via SSE transport

    Use MCPServerSse with your Vinkius endpoint URL. Replace [YOUR_TOKEN_HERE] with your token from cloud.vinkius.com. The SDK auto-discovers all MoeGo tools at runtime.

  3. 3

    Create your Agent

    Pass the MCP to Agent(mcp_servers=[server]). The agent receives MoeGo tools as native definitions — JSON schemas resolve automatically.

  4. 4

    Run the agent

    Call Runner.run(agent, prompt) to execute. The agent invokes the appropriate MoeGo tools and returns structured results. Copy the full example on the right to get started.

agent.py
import asyncio
from agents import Agent, Runner
from agents.mcp import MCPServerSse

async def main():
    async with MCPServerSse(
        url="https://edge.vinkius.com/[YOUR_TOKEN_HERE]/mcp"
    ) as server:
        agent = Agent(
            name="MoeGo Agent",
            instructions="You have access to MoeGo tools.",
            mcp_servers=[server],
        )
        result = await Runner.run(agent, "List recent transactions")
        print(result.final_output)

asyncio.run(main())

Independent Platform Disclaimer: Vinkius is an independent platform and is not affiliated with, endorsed by, sponsored by, verified by, or otherwise authorized by MoeGo. All third-party trademarks, logos, and brand names are the property of their respective owners. Their use on this website is strictly for informational purposes to identify service compatibility and interoperability.

Why Choose Vinkius

Vinkius connects your tools to AI with real-time monitoring and automatic cost savings — all from one dashboard.

Real-time monitoring

Live

visibility into every interaction

Connect your favorite tools to your AI and see exactly what's happening — every request, every response, in real time.

Built-in savings

60%

lower AI costs

Vinkius compresses data between your apps and your AI automatically. Lower bills every month — no configuration required.

Single dashboard

One

place for every integration

Every tool your AI connects to, managed from a single screen. One account, complete control.

Common questions about MoeGo MCP in OpenAI Agents SDK

Install the package using `pip install openai-agents` and initialize the server stream. Pass the server configuration to the `Agent` constructor using `mcp_servers=[server]` to let the agent auto-discover tools like `list_appointments` and `create_appointment`.
Yes, set `cacheToolsList=True` in your agent setup. This prevents the agent from making redundant roundtrips to retrieve the tool schema, making calls to `get_pet` or `list_services` significantly faster.
The SDK validates the parameters for tools like `create_appointment` against the JSON schema before execution. This prevents the agent from writing broken dates or assigning non-existent staff IDs to a grooming booking.
Yes. You can build one agent that reads reviews via `list_reviews` and another that pulls customer profiles with `list_customers`. The SDK handles the handoff when an unhappy customer needs their profile updated or a follow-up scheduled.
All calls to `list_pets` and customer contact details run in an ephemeral sandbox environment. This MCP setup ensures your API keys are never exposed to the LLM, and the platform handles the authorization token securely, ensuring pet and customer data never leaks.

Start using the MoeGo MCP today

We host it, we monitor it, we maintain it. You just paste one token.

Built & Managed by Vinkius 30s setup 10 tools

We've already built the connector for MoeGo. Just plug in your AI agents and start using Vinkius.

No hosting. No infrastructure. No complex setup.
All 10 tools are live and waiting. You're up and running in seconds.

Claude Claude
ChatGPT ChatGPT
Cursor Cursor
Gemini Gemini
Windsurf Windsurf
VS Code VS Code
JetBrains JetBrains
Vercel Vercel
+ other MCP clients

Vinkius gives your AI agents access to the full catalog of app connectors, all fully managed, secure, and enterprise-ready. One subscription, every tool you need.

Zero hosting required Full MCP catalog included Enterprise-grade security Auto-updated by Vinkius

Built, hosted, and secured by Vinkius. You just connect and go.